Document

Indicates that the message processing by the authentication module was successful and that the runtime is to proceed with its normal processing of the resulting message.

Usage

From source file:org.josso.jaspi.agent.JASPISSOAuthModule.java

@Override
public AuthStatus validateRequest(MessageInfo messageInfo, Subject clientSubject, Subject serviceSubject)
        throws AuthException {

    HttpServletRequest hreq = (HttpServletRequest) messageInfo.getRequestMessage();
    HttpServletResponse hres = (HttpServletResponse) messageInfo.getResponseMessage();

    if (log.isDebugEnabled()) {
        log.debug("Processing : " + hreq.getContextPath() + " [" + hreq.getRequestURL() + "]");
    }/*  w ww  . j av  a 2 s .co  m*/

    try {
        // ------------------------------------------------------------------
        // Check with the agent if this context should be processed.
        // ------------------------------------------------------------------
        String contextPath = hreq.getContextPath();
        String vhost = hreq.getServerName();

        // In catalina, the empty context is considered the root context
        if ("".equals(contextPath)) {
            contextPath = "/";
        }

        if (!_agent.isPartnerApp(vhost, contextPath)) {
            if (log.isDebugEnabled()) {
                log.debug("Context is not a josso partner app : " + hreq.getContextPath());
            }
            AuthStatus status = AuthStatus.SUCCESS;
            return status;
        }

        // ------------------------------------------------------------------
        // Check some basic HTTP handling
        // ------------------------------------------------------------------
        // P3P Header for IE 6+ compatibility when embedding JOSSO in a IFRAME
        SSOPartnerAppConfig cfg = _agent.getPartnerAppConfig(vhost, contextPath);
        if (cfg.isSendP3PHeader() && !hres.isCommitted()) {
            hres.setHeader("P3P", cfg.getP3PHeaderValue());
        }

        // Get our session ...
        HttpSession session = hreq.getSession(true);

        // ------------------------------------------------------------------
        // Check if the partner application required the login form
        // ------------------------------------------------------------------
        if (log.isDebugEnabled()) {
            log.debug("Checking if its a josso_login_request for '" + hreq.getRequestURI() + "'");
        }

        if (hreq.getRequestURI().endsWith(_agent.getJossoLoginUri())
                || hreq.getRequestURI().endsWith(_agent.getJossoUserLoginUri())) {

            if (log.isDebugEnabled()) {
                log.debug("josso_login_request received for uri '" + hreq.getRequestURI() + "'");
            }

            //save referer url in case the user clicked on Login from some public resource (page)
            //so agent can redirect the user back to that page after successful login
            if (hreq.getRequestURI().endsWith(_agent.getJossoUserLoginUri())) {
                saveLoginBackToURL(hreq, hres, session, true);
            } else {
                saveLoginBackToURL(hreq, hres, session, false);
            }

            String loginUrl = _agent.buildLoginUrl(hreq);

            if (log.isDebugEnabled()) {
                log.debug("Redirecting to login url '" + loginUrl + "'");
            }

            //set non cache headers
            _agent.prepareNonCacheResponse(hres);
            hres.sendRedirect(hres.encodeRedirectURL(loginUrl));

            // Request is authorized for this URI
            return AuthStatus.SEND_CONTINUE;
        }

        // ------------------------------------------------------------------
        // Check if the partner application required a logout
        // ------------------------------------------------------------------
        if (log.isDebugEnabled()) {
            log.debug("Checking if its a josso_logout request for '" + hreq.getRequestURI() + "'");
        }

        if (hreq.getRequestURI().endsWith(_agent.getJossoLogoutUri())) {

            if (log.isDebugEnabled()) {
                log.debug("josso_logout request received for uri '" + hreq.getRequestURI() + "'");
            }

            String logoutUrl = _agent.buildLogoutUrl(hreq, cfg);

            if (log.isDebugEnabled()) {
                log.debug("Redirecting to logout url '" + logoutUrl + "'");
            }

            // Clear previous COOKIE ...
            Cookie ssoCookie = _agent.newJossoCookie(hreq.getContextPath(), "-", hreq.isSecure());
            hres.addCookie(ssoCookie);

            // invalidate session (unbind josso security context)
            session.invalidate();

            //set non cache headers
            _agent.prepareNonCacheResponse(hres);
            hres.sendRedirect(hres.encodeRedirectURL(logoutUrl));

            // Request is authorized for this URI
            return AuthStatus.SEND_CONTINUE;
        }

        // ------------------------------------------------------------------
        // Check for the single sign on cookie
        // ------------------------------------------------------------------
        if (log.isDebugEnabled()) {
            log.debug("Checking for SSO cookie");
        }
        Cookie cookie = null;
        Cookie cookies[] = hreq.getCookies();
        if (cookies == null) {
            cookies = new Cookie[0];
        }
        for (int i = 0; i < cookies.length; i++) {
            if (org.josso.gateway.Constants.JOSSO_SINGLE_SIGN_ON_COOKIE.equals(cookies[i].getName())) {
                cookie = cookies[i];
                break;
            }
        }

        String jossoSessionId = (cookie == null) ? null : cookie.getValue();
        if (log.isDebugEnabled()) {
            log.debug("Session is: " + session);
        }

        // Get session map for this servlet context.
        Map sessionMap = (Map) hreq.getSession().getServletContext().getAttribute(KEY_SESSION_MAP);
        if (sessionMap == null) {
            synchronized (this) {
                sessionMap = (Map) hreq.getSession().getServletContext().getAttribute(KEY_SESSION_MAP);
                if (sessionMap == null) {
                    sessionMap = Collections.synchronizedMap(new HashMap());
                    hreq.getSession().getServletContext().setAttribute(KEY_SESSION_MAP, sessionMap);
                }
            }
        }

        LocalSession localSession = (LocalSession) sessionMap.get(session.getId());
        if (localSession == null) {
            localSession = new JASPILocalSession(session);
            // the local session is new so, make the valve listen for its events so that it can
            // map them to local session events.
            // Not Supported : session.addSessionListener(this);
            sessionMap.put(session.getId(), localSession);

        }

        // ------------------------------------------------------------------
        // Check if the partner application submitted custom login form
        // ------------------------------------------------------------------

        if (log.isDebugEnabled()) {
            log.debug("Checking if its a josso_authentication for '" + hreq.getRequestURI() + "'");
        }
        if (hreq.getRequestURI().endsWith(_agent.getJossoAuthenticationUri())) {

            if (log.isDebugEnabled()) {
                log.debug("josso_authentication received for uri '" + hreq.getRequestURI() + "'");
            }

            JASPISSOAgentRequest customAuthRequest = (JASPISSOAgentRequest) doMakeSSOAgentRequest(cfg.getId(),
                    SSOAgentRequest.ACTION_CUSTOM_AUTHENTICATION, jossoSessionId, localSession, null, hreq,
                    hres);

            _agent.processRequest(customAuthRequest);

            // Request is authorized
            return AuthStatus.SEND_CONTINUE;
        }

        if (cookie == null || cookie.getValue().equals("-")) {

            // ------------------------------------------------------------------
            // Trigger LOGIN OPTIONAL if required
            // ------------------------------------------------------------------

            if (log.isDebugEnabled())
                log.debug("SSO cookie is not present, verifying optional login process ");

            // We have no cookie, remember me is enabled and a security check without assertion was received ...
            // This means that the user could not be identified ... go back to the original resource
            if (hreq.getRequestURI().endsWith(_agent.getJossoSecurityCheckUri())
                    && hreq.getParameter("josso_assertion_id") == null) {

                if (log.isDebugEnabled())
                    log.debug(_agent.getJossoSecurityCheckUri()
                            + " received without assertion.  Login Optional Process failed");

                String requestURI = this.getSavedRequestURL(hreq);
                _agent.prepareNonCacheResponse(hres);
                hres.sendRedirect(hres.encodeRedirectURL(requestURI));
                AuthStatus status = AuthStatus.SEND_CONTINUE;
                return status;
            }

            // This is a standard anonymous request!
            if (!hreq.getRequestURI().endsWith(_agent.getJossoSecurityCheckUri())) {

                // If saved request is NOT null, we're in the middle of another process ...
                if (!_agent.isResourceIgnored(cfg, hreq) && _agent.isAutomaticLoginRequired(hreq, hres)) {

                    if (log.isDebugEnabled()) {
                        log.debug("SSO cookie is not present, attempting automatic login");
                    }

                    // Save current request, so we can co back to it later ...
                    saveRequestURL(hreq, hres);
                    String loginUrl = _agent.buildLoginOptionalUrl(hreq);

                    if (log.isDebugEnabled()) {
                        log.debug("Redirecting to login url '" + loginUrl + "'");
                    }

                    //set non cache headers
                    _agent.prepareNonCacheResponse(hres);
                    hres.sendRedirect(hres.encodeRedirectURL(loginUrl));
                    //hreq.getRequestDispatcher(loginUrl).forward(hreq, hres);
                    AuthStatus status = AuthStatus.SEND_CONTINUE;
                    return status;
                } else {
                    if (log.isDebugEnabled()) {
                        log.debug("SSO cookie is not present, but login optional process is not required");
                    }
                }
            }

            if (log.isDebugEnabled()) {
                log.debug("SSO cookie is not present, checking for outbound relaying");
            }

            if (!(hreq.getRequestURI().endsWith(_agent.getJossoSecurityCheckUri())
                    && hreq.getParameter("josso_assertion_id") != null)) {
                log.debug("SSO cookie not present and relaying was not requested, skipping");
                AuthStatus status = AuthStatus.SUCCESS;
                return status;
            }

        }

        // ------------------------------------------------------------------
        // Check if this URI is subject to SSO protection
        // ------------------------------------------------------------------
        if (_agent.isResourceIgnored(cfg, hreq)) {
            // Ignored resources are authorized
            return AuthStatus.SUCCESS;
        }

        // This URI should be protected by SSO, go on ...
        if (log.isDebugEnabled()) {
            log.debug("Session is: " + session);
        }

        // ------------------------------------------------------------------
        // Invoke the SSO Agent
        // ------------------------------------------------------------------
        if (log.isDebugEnabled()) {
            log.debug("Executing agent...");
        }

        // ------------------------------------------------------------------
        // Check if a user has been authenticated and should be checked by the agent.
        // ------------------------------------------------------------------
        if (log.isDebugEnabled()) {
            log.debug("Checking if its a josso_security_check for '" + hreq.getRequestURI() + "'");
        }

        if (hreq.getRequestURI().endsWith(_agent.getJossoSecurityCheckUri())
                && hreq.getParameter("josso_assertion_id") != null) {

            if (log.isDebugEnabled()) {
                log.debug("josso_security_check received for uri '" + hreq.getRequestURI() + "' assertion id '"
                        + hreq.getParameter("josso_assertion_id"));
            }

            String assertionId = hreq.getParameter(Constants.JOSSO_ASSERTION_ID_PARAMETER);

            JASPISSOAgentRequest relayRequest;

            if (log.isDebugEnabled()) {
                log.debug("Outbound relaying requested for assertion id [" + assertionId + "]");
            }

            relayRequest = (JASPISSOAgentRequest) doMakeSSOAgentRequest(cfg.getId(),
                    SSOAgentRequest.ACTION_RELAY, null, localSession, assertionId, hreq, hres);

            SingleSignOnEntry entry = _agent.processRequest(relayRequest);
            if (entry == null) {
                // This is wrong! We should have an entry here!
                if (log.isDebugEnabled()) {
                    log.debug("Outbound relaying failed for assertion id [" + assertionId
                            + "], no Principal found.");
                }
                // Throw an exception, we will handle it below !
                throw new RuntimeException(
                        "Outbound relaying failed. No Principal found. Verify your SSO Agent Configuration!");
            } else {
                // Add the SSOUser as a Principal
                if (!clientSubject.getPrincipals().contains(entry.principal)) {
                    clientSubject.getPrincipals().add(entry.principal);
                }
                SSORole[] ssoRolePrincipals = _agent.getRoleSets(cfg.getId(), entry.ssoId,
                        relayRequest.getNodeId());
                List<String> rolesList = new ArrayList<String>();

                for (int i = 0; i < ssoRolePrincipals.length; i++) {
                    if (clientSubject.getPrincipals().contains(ssoRolePrincipals[i])) {
                        continue;
                    }
                    rolesList.add(ssoRolePrincipals[i].getName());

                    clientSubject.getPrincipals().add(ssoRolePrincipals[i]);
                    log.debug("Added SSORole Principal to the Subject : " + ssoRolePrincipals[i]);
                }

                registerWithCallbackHandler(entry.principal, entry.principal.getName(), entry.ssoId,
                        rolesList.toArray(new String[rolesList.size()]));
            }

            if (log.isDebugEnabled()) {
                log.debug("Outbound relaying succesfull for assertion id [" + assertionId + "]");
            }

            if (log.isDebugEnabled()) {
                log.debug("Assertion id [" + assertionId + "] mapped to SSO session id [" + entry.ssoId + "]");
            }

            // The cookie is valid to for the partner application only ... in the future each partner app may
            // store a different auth. token (SSO SESSION) value
            cookie = _agent.newJossoCookie(hreq.getContextPath(), entry.ssoId, hreq.isSecure());
            hres.addCookie(cookie);

            //Redirect user to the saved splash resource (in case of auth request) or to request URI otherwise
            String requestURI = getSavedSplashResource(hreq);
            if (requestURI == null) {
                requestURI = getSavedRequestURL(hreq);
                if (requestURI == null) {

                    if (cfg.getDefaultResource() != null) {
                        requestURI = cfg.getDefaultResource();
                    } else {
                        // If no saved request is found, redirect to the partner app root :
                        requestURI = hreq.getRequestURI().substring(0,
                                (hreq.getRequestURI().length() - _agent.getJossoSecurityCheckUri().length()));
                    }

                    // If we're behind a reverse proxy, we have to alter the URL ... this was not necessary on tomcat 5.0 ?!
                    String singlePointOfAccess = _agent.getSinglePointOfAccess();
                    if (singlePointOfAccess != null) {
                        requestURI = singlePointOfAccess + requestURI;
                    } else {
                        String reverseProxyHost = hreq
                                .getHeader(org.josso.gateway.Constants.JOSSO_REVERSE_PROXY_HEADER);
                        if (reverseProxyHost != null) {
                            requestURI = reverseProxyHost + requestURI;
                        }
                    }

                    if (log.isDebugEnabled())
                        log.debug("No saved request found, using : '" + requestURI + "'");
                }
            }

            _agent.clearAutomaticLoginReferer(hreq, hres);
            _agent.prepareNonCacheResponse(hres);

            // Check if we have a post login resource :
            String postAuthURI = cfg.getPostAuthenticationResource();
            if (postAuthURI != null) {
                String postAuthURL = _agent.buildPostAuthUrl(hres, requestURI, postAuthURI);
                if (log.isDebugEnabled()) {
                    log.debug("Redirecting to post-auth-resource '" + postAuthURL + "'");
                }
                hres.sendRedirect(postAuthURL);
            } else {
                if (log.isDebugEnabled()) {
                    log.debug("Redirecting to original '" + requestURI + "'");
                }
                hres.sendRedirect(hres.encodeRedirectURL(requestURI));
            }

            AuthStatus status = AuthStatus.SEND_SUCCESS;
            return status;
        }

        if (log.isDebugEnabled()) {
            log.debug("Creating Security Context for Session [" + session + "]");
        }
        SSOAgentRequest r = doMakeSSOAgentRequest(cfg.getId(),
                SSOAgentRequest.ACTION_ESTABLISH_SECURITY_CONTEXT, jossoSessionId, localSession, null, hreq,
                hres);
        SingleSignOnEntry entry = _agent.processRequest(r);

        if (log.isDebugEnabled()) {
            log.debug("Executed agent.");
        }

        // ------------------------------------------------------------------
        // Has a valid user already been authenticated?
        // ------------------------------------------------------------------
        if (log.isDebugEnabled()) {
            log.debug("Process request for '" + hreq.getRequestURI() + "'");
        }

        if (entry != null) {
            if (log.isDebugEnabled()) {
                log.debug("Principal '" + entry.principal + "' has already been authenticated");
            }
            // Add the SSOUser as a Principal
            if (!clientSubject.getPrincipals().contains(entry.principal)) {
                clientSubject.getPrincipals().add(entry.principal);
            }
            SSORole[] ssoRolePrincipals = _agent.getRoleSets(cfg.getId(), entry.ssoId, r.getNodeId());
            List<String> rolesList = new ArrayList<String>();
            for (int i = 0; i < ssoRolePrincipals.length; i++) {
                if (clientSubject.getPrincipals().contains(ssoRolePrincipals[i])) {
                    continue;
                }
                rolesList.add(ssoRolePrincipals[i].getName());
                clientSubject.getPrincipals().add(ssoRolePrincipals[i]);
                log.debug("Added SSORole Principal to the Subject : " + ssoRolePrincipals[i]);
            }
            registerWithCallbackHandler(entry.principal, entry.principal.getName(), entry.ssoId,
                    rolesList.toArray(new String[rolesList.size()]));
        } else {
            log.debug("No Valid SSO Session, attempt an optional login?");
            // This is a standard anonymous request!

            if (cookie != null) {
                // cookie is not valid
                cookie = _agent.newJossoCookie(hreq.getContextPath(), "-", hreq.isSecure());
                hres.addCookie(cookie);
            }

            if (cookie != null
                    || (getSavedRequestURL(hreq) == null && _agent.isAutomaticLoginRequired(hreq, hres))) {
                if (log.isDebugEnabled()) {
                    log.debug("SSO Session is not valid, attempting automatic login");
                }

                // Save current request, so we can co back to it later ...
                saveRequestURL(hreq, hres);
                String loginUrl = _agent.buildLoginOptionalUrl(hreq);

                if (log.isDebugEnabled()) {
                    log.debug("Redirecting to login url '" + loginUrl + "'");
                }

                //set non cache headers
                _agent.prepareNonCacheResponse(hres);
                hres.sendRedirect(hres.encodeRedirectURL(loginUrl));

                // Request is authorized for this URI
                return AuthStatus.SEND_CONTINUE;
            } else {
                if (log.isDebugEnabled()) {
                    log.debug("SSO cookie is not present, but login optional process is not required");
                }
            }

        }

        // propagate the login and logout URLs to
        // partner applications.
        hreq.setAttribute("org.josso.agent.gateway-login-url", _agent.getGatewayLoginUrl());
        hreq.setAttribute("org.josso.agent.gateway-logout-url", _agent.getGatewayLogoutUrl());
        hreq.setAttribute("org.josso.agent.ssoSessionid", jossoSessionId);

        clearSavedRequestURLs(hreq, hres);

        AuthStatus status = AuthStatus.SUCCESS;
        return status;
    } catch (Throwable t) {
        log.warn(t.getMessage(), t);
        throw new AuthException(t.getMessage());
        //return AuthStatus.FAILURE;
    } finally {
        if (log.isDebugEnabled()) {
            log.debug("Processed : " + hreq.getContextPath() + " [" + hreq.getRequestURL() + "]");
        }
    }
}
